Transaction 65cccbf39e50e160bf0afc5879d779d322ab95022d1bc6a9e9b8754d8abc101a

2 Input
1 Outputs
  • 65cccbf39e50e160bf0afc5879d779d322ab95022d1bc6a9e9b8754d8abc101a:0
  • value  504964
    address  1Ch6eCmQuMfpHn8fkWceQYw3ABZfmQuTWh